IEUX.AS vs. IESE.AS
IEUX.AS (iShares MSCI Europe ex-UK UCITS ETF) and IESE.AS (iShares MSCI Europe SRI UCITS ETF EUR (Acc)) are both Europe Equities funds from iShares - IEUX.AS tracks the MSCI Europe Ex UK NR EUR while IESE.AS tracks the MSCI Europe NR EUR. Both are passively managed. Over the past 10 years, IEUX.AS returned 9.33%/yr vs 7.82%/yr for IESE.AS. Their correlation of 0.85 suggests significant overlap in exposure. IEUX.AS charges 0.40%/yr vs 0.20%/yr for IESE.AS.
